Safety concerns re durability of materials used – The strings which attach the sloths and whales deteriorate, making it unsafe for baby. Poor customer service too
Lacking basic quality – The regular retail price of this product is an insane $99.95. For that price, you would expect at least basic safety quality for a product intended… Read more
for use with babies, unfortunately, that's not the case.
Upon first set up, one of the fabric animals fell into the bassinet after the single stitch attaching it to the thread tied to the hanger came loose, posing a legitimate choking threat. This goes against basic Safe Sleeping Practices for Newborns, as advised by Red Nose Australia,
On closer inspection, another entire length of attached items fell loose with the slightest touch from my hand.
On seperate from the lack of quality control in regards to safety. The item is marketed as musical, but not clearly describing the fact you need to manually turn the motor and can only turn it enough to have the music play for around 1 minute at most.
If you're looking for a musical item to have continually playing for your infant, this does not fulfil the purpose.
For the price, this product is terribly lacking in described use, and should be discontinued for safety concerns.
